Job summary

ICF is seeking a Florida‑licensed Professional Geologist On‑Call to join our Environment & Planning team. This role involves applying geological principles to support environmental planning projects and resource evaluation, primarily performing Oil, Gas, and Mineral (OGM) assessments for less‑than‑fee easement acquisitions.

Responsibilities

  • Perform Oil, Gas, and Mineral (OGM) assessments to evaluate the presence, quality, and/or development potential of mineral resources that underlie properties considered for less‑than‑fee acquisitions.
  • Evaluate information from the Florida Department of Environmental Protection (DEP) oil and gas permitting database, mines database, and local/regional geologic maps and reports.
  • Prepare a brief technical report summarizing the OGM assessment, including a GIS map exhibit and supplementary data such as well‑borehole information.
  • Perform other geology‑related tasks as needed in support of the Environment & Planning division.
  • Collaborate with project managers, technical specialists, and regulatory stakeholders.
